Bands often come with their fair share of drama, so when the world’s most popular groups from the past successfully get back together, it’s always cause for celebration.

Last month, British-Irish sensation Girls Aloud announced it would be embarking on a reunion tour in 2024 to celebrate its biggest hits – including “Sound of the Underground”, “Love Machine” and “Jump” – and the memory of bandmate Sarah Harding. She died at the age of 39 in 2021 following a battle with breast cancer, sending shock waves through the music industry.

Girls Aloud was formed in 2002 through reality show Popstars: The Rivals, and announced its split in 2013. While some friendships remained tight over the years, others became strained. However, after Harding’s passing, the four singers decided to put their differences aside to celebrate her and their legacy.

4. Kimberley Walsh, 42

Estimated net worth: US$10 million

After releasing solo album Centre Stage in 2013, Walsh quickly changed course, focusing on theatre and television work instead. She appeared in reality shows The Masked Dancer and Strictly Come Dancing, and showed off her acting skills on the West End in productions of Shrek: The Musical, Sleepless: A Musical Romance and Elf: The Musical.

Now married to former boy band singer Justin Scott, Walsh lives a fairly low-key life with her husband and three kids.

3. Nadine Coyle, 38

Estimated net worth: US$13 million

After Girls Aloud split, Nadine Coyle attempted a solo career that sadly never really took off. After releasing a debut album and EP, her first solo tour was cancelled in 2018 and never rescheduled. Instead, she moved to the US where she opened a bar called Nadine’s Irish Mist.

During her time in Los Angeles, the Irish star got engaged to American footballer Jason Bell and the pair had one daughter together, Anaíya Bell, who was born in 2014. The couple have since split, the bar closed its doors, and Coyle relocated back to Northern Ireland to raise her daughter away from the limelight.

Coyle and her bandmate Cheryl were famously embroiled in a long-standing feud over the years, so the reunion news hopefully means that’s all water under the bridge now.

2. Nicola Roberts, 38

Estimated net worth: US$13 million

Nicola Roberts was undoubtedly one of the best voices in the group, but much like her bandmates, her solo career failed to take off. She released debut album Cinderella’s Eyes in 2011, which peaked at No 17 in the UK charts, and while she worked on new music afterwards, nothing was ever released. Instead, Roberts started writing music for other artists, including bandmate Cheryl and Little Mix.

However, Roberts made a triumphant return to the stage when she won The Masked Singer in 2020 performing as “Queen Bee”. Since then, she’s done a variety of notable performances, including Queen Elizabeth’s Platinum Jubilee in 2022.

1. Cheryl, 40

Estimated net worth: US$40 million

Born Cheryl Tweedy, the singer changed her last name to Cole when she married British footballer Ashley Cole. Following their split, she changed her name again when she briefly wed French restaurateur Jean-Bernard Fernandez-Versini. After being known by three different surnames, she eventually decided to stick to her first name, Cheryl.

Following the group’s success, Cheryl went on to launch a solo career to mixed success, dropping hits like “Fight For This Love” and “3 Words”. Once known as “Britain’s golden girl”, she was a judge on The X Factor UK and The Greatest Dancer. These days, she’s a full time mum to son Bear, who she shares with One Direction star Liam Payne.
